Credit Karma: Free Credit Monitoring and Much More Credit Karma started out as an online credit monitoring site. Over the past few years it expanded into a comprehensive free financial management services. Besides credit monitoring, CrediKarma offers loan calculators, loan shopping resources, spending trackers and more. This is a deep dive into their most important features. Credit Monitoring: FICO or FAKO is Credit Karma’s flagship feature. They offer free snapshots of your entire credit report from TransUnion and Equifax. They organize your credit information in meaningful categories like hard credit inquiries, new Accounts, and negative information. The categories that they use correspond to the Vantage 3.0 credit score. Some users will struggle with the Vantage 3.0 credit score. It is not the FICO 8 credit score that you see most of the time. The same bank will use a different credit score for an auto loan compared to a credit card. Credit scoring models consider information as varied as your income, your location and how you applied for credit. The Vantage 3.0 credit score isn’t a fake score, but it isn’t the same as the FICO 8 credit score. Below, you can compare the Vantage 3.0 to the FICO 8. Vantage does not for their algorithm, so the ratios are estimates. The variables between the Vantage 3.0 and the FICO 8 differ somewhat. However, the biggest issue you might have with the scores are the treatment of collections accounts. FICO 8 treats unpaid and paid collections the same.
